    Structure of the Internet was developed through last 30 years of existence of the Internet. The Internet is a heterogeneous worldwide network consisting of a large number of host computers and local area networks. The Internet uses the TCP/IP suite of protocols. This allows the integration of a large number of different computers into one single network with highly efficient communication between them.     some software‚ some both: Communication software - programs used to provide remote access to systems‚ and exchange files and messages in text‚ audio and/or video formats between different computers or users. Communication software runs on computers‚ tablets‚ mobile phones and other specialized devices. Some examples of remote communication software are terminal emulators‚ file transfer programs; instant messaging programs‚ real time chat programs (IRC)‚ teleconferencing and video conferencing software
